Finding maximum value and corresponding variable

조회 수: 8 (최근 30일)
Mohammad Sohel Rana
Mohammad Sohel Rana 2019년 6월 24일
댓글: Mohammad Sohel Rana 2019년 6월 24일
Dear Matlab expert
P(m,d,L) is a matix and size of P(m,d,L) is [10 40 10]. Total element =10*40*10=4000;
Now I need to find maximum value(one maximum value) for P and corresponding m,d,L.
I am expecting your kind help.
Kind regards
Sohel

채택된 답변

the cyclist
the cyclist 2019년 6월 24일
P = rand(10,40,10); % Some pretend data
[P_max,linear_index_max] = max(P(:)); % Find max and index, for linearized matrix
[mc,dc,Lc] = ind2sub([10 40 10],linear_index_max); % Convert the linear index to subscripts

추가 답변 (0개)

카테고리

Help CenterFile Exchange에서 Linear Algebra에 대해 자세히 알아보기

태그

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by